问题标签 [textmate]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
keyboard-shortcuts - 如何将 TextMate 的 ^H 键绑定更改为删除而不是显示帮助?
我来自 Emacs 背景,习惯于输入 ^H 来删除前一个字符。TextMate 改为显示捆绑帮助。我还没有找到改变这个绑定的方法。有办法吗?
vim - RSync 保存在 VIM 中
我正在寻找一种映射 :w 命令的方法,以便当我使用它时,它将 rsync 当前目录并保存有问题的文件。理想情况下,rsync 命令生成的响应应该在 vim 中返回,但不是在当前文件中,而是作为工具提示或其他东西。
我设法在 TextMate 中实现了这一点,现在正准备开始使用 Vim。我一直在尝试类似的东西:map w :w|!rsync
,但这似乎不起作用。
eclipse - Flex Builder 或 Eclipse 中是否存在 textmate 垂直选择功能?
在 OS X 上的 textmate 中,当您选择文本时,有一个方便的功能。
如果您按住选项键,光标会变成十字准线,您可以选择文本的垂直列并将其粘贴回垂直列,并保留行行。
Flex Builder 或 Eclipse 是否具有相同的功能?不知道该怎么称呼它。
如果是这样,关键组合是什么?
c# - 如何使用 TextMate 作为我的 IDE 在 C# 中编程?
是的,我知道有MonoDevelop。但是,如果我想改用Textmate怎么办?
所以我的问题是针对使用 Textmate 开发了一些 C# 应用程序的 .Net 开发人员。我很好奇他们的流程/工作流程与此设置有关。
- 对于语法/语言语法,最好的 C# 包是什么?
- 你如何构建你的项目?(易于为 2.0、3.0 和/或 3.5 框架构建应用程序?)
- 您能否在 Visual Studio 中轻松启动 C# 应用程序,然后继续使用 TextMate 代替它?
认为我可以做到这一点是否有太多陷阱,我只是在服用疯狂的药丸吗?
textmate - 编辑 Textmate 语法高亮?
我最近开始在 Textmate 中使用 Objective-C 并注意到语法突出显示效果很差(注释与变量声明的颜色完全相同)。我从来没有在 Textmate 中进行过语法高亮更改,而且我在弄清楚如何正确修改它时遇到了麻烦。例如,Objective-c 文件中注释的范围是:source.objc.iphone meta.implementation.objc meta.scope.implementation.objc meta.function-with-body.objc
但是改变它的颜色不仅仅是评论。
有谁知道开始学习如何做到这一点的好地方?
ide - TextMate 可以找到匹配的开始和结束标签吗?
我在 Visual Studio 中喜欢的一点是我可以单击一个开始标签,比如说,它会尽最大努力以粗体突出显示结束标签。有谁知道你是否可以在 textmate 中做到这一点?我搜索了一下,但找不到它。
很难找到许多 DIV 深的结束标签。
如果 TextMate 不会这样做,谁能告诉我 Mac 上的编辑器会这样做吗?
感谢您的任何帮助。
编辑:如果可以的话,有人可以告诉我怎么做吗?再次感谢。
ruby - 来自 Textmate 的 Ruby RI 文档查找
我在 Textmate 中查找 Ruby 文档时遇到问题。我将 Ruby 1.9.1 安装到 /usr/local/bin ,但是当我使用Ctrl+H
Ruby 包查找单词时,出现此错误:
/Users/joshuaaburto/Library/Application Support/TextMate/Pristine Copy/Support/lib/web_preview.rb:101:警告:'end' 处的缩进与 98 /usr/local/lib/ruby/1.9 处的'if' 不匹配。 1/rdoc/ri/driver.rb:661:in
initialize': Permission denied - /Users/joshuaaburto/.ri/cache/ActionController-Base (Errno::EACCES) from /usr/local/lib/ruby/1.9.1/rdoc/ri/driver.rb:661:in
open' 来自 /usr/local/lib/ruby/1.9.1/rdoc/ri/driver.rb:661:inwrite_cache' from /usr/local/lib/ruby/1.9.1/rdoc/ri/driver.rb:507:in
create_cache_for' 来自 /usr/local/lib/ ruby/1.9.1/rdoc/ri/driver.rb:469:inload_cache_for' from /usr/local/lib/ruby/1.9.1/rdoc/ri/driver.rb:648:in
块(2 级)在 select_methods' from /usr/local/lib/ruby/1.9.1/rdoc/ri/driver.rb:647:ineach' from /usr/local/lib/ruby/1.9.1/rdoc/ri/driver.rb:647:in
grep' 来自 /usr/local/lib/ruby/1.9.1/rdoc/ri/driver.rb:647:inblock in select_methods' from /usr/local/lib/ruby/1.9.1/rdoc/ri/driver.rb:646:in
each' 来自 /usr/local/lib/ruby/1.9.1/rdoc/ri/driver.rb :646:inselect_methods' from /usr/local/lib/ruby/1.9.1/rdoc/ri/driver.rb:624:in
block in run' from /usr/local/lib/ruby/1.9.1/rdoc/ri/driver.rb:590:ineach' from /usr/local/lib/ruby/1.9.1/rdoc/ri/driver.rb:590:in
run' from /usr/local/lib/ruby/1.9.1/rdoc /ri/driver.rb:300:inrun' from /usr/local/bin/ri:5:in
'
谁能建议我如何正确编辑 RI 权限或 Ruby textmate 包以使用文档功能?
django - Django + Emacs(作为 TextMate 的替代品)
有没有完整的教程如何配置 emacs 以与 Django (1.1) 一起使用(在 Mac 上)?我正在考虑从 TextMate 切换到 Emacs,以便为 django 提供多平台编辑器。我有我的最爱。来自textmate的主题,我想将其转换为emacs(也许是“转换器”?)。从 Textmate 切换是个好主意?
ruby - 如何在 TextMate 中突出显示变量的所有实例?
如果将光标放在 NetBeans 中的一个变量上(至少在 Ruby 代码中),它会突出显示该变量的所有实例。这是我非常喜欢的一个功能。
TextMate 或某些捆绑软件有类似的功能吗?
keyboard-shortcuts - 为什么不能在 mac os x 和 Textmate 上将 ctrl + tab 设置为键盘快捷键?
我切换到 Textmate 并想用Command+切换选项卡Tab(就像在 NetBeans 中一样)。
菜单命令是导航 - 下一个文件选项卡。但是不能用Tab键设置任何快捷方式?这是一般限制吗?